Tomatillo Taco Joint

320 Elm St, New Haven, CT 06511
Tomatillo Taco Joint Tomatillo Taco Joint is one of the popular Local Business located in 320 Elm St ,New Haven listed under Local business in New Haven , Mexican Restaurant in New Haven , Take Out Restaurant in New Haven ,

Contact Details & Working Hours

Map of Tomatillo Taco Joint